The SOUND100_AP is an EN54-3 compliant indoor sounder with a built-in short circuit isolator, designed for fire alarm systems. It features programmable addresses, operates at a voltage of 27V, and has a sound output of 80-100 dB. Regular maintenance is required, and the device should be replaced after 10 years of continuous use to ensure optimal performance.
